OIC Secy-Gen Welcomes Member States on Advent of Ramadan

OIC Secretary-General Hissein Brahim Taha



Jeddah, 28 February , 2025 - H.E. the Secretary-General of the Organization of Islamic Cooperation (OIC), Mr. Hissein Brahim Taha, extended his warmest congratulations and greetings to the entire Muslim Ummah on the occasion of the advent of the holy month of Ramadan for the year 1446 Hijri, and to the OIC Member States, expressing his congratulations to the host country, the Kingdom of Saudi Arabia, under the leadership of the Custodian of the Two Holy Mosques, King Salman bin Abdulaziz Al Saud, and his faithful Crown Prince, Prime Minister, His Royal Highness Prince Mohammed bin Salman bin Abdulaziz Al Saud, and to all leaders of the OIC Member States, and all Muslim peoples on the occasion of the advent of the holy month of goodness and blessings.

Mr. Hissein Brahim Taha prayed to Allah Almighty to bestow His blessings and serenity on the Muslim Ummah in this holy month, leading to the end of crises and conflicts in various parts of the Muslim world.

The Secretary-General expressed his deep sorrow and concern over the tragic conditions experienced by the population of the Gaza Strip, which has been stricken by the brutal Israeli aggression for a year and four months, along with expressing his concern over the ongoing Israeli crimes and attacks on the West Bank, occupied Al-Quds and the blessed Al-Aqsa Mosque.

The Secretary-General expressed his wishes that Allah Almighty would grant the Palestinian people His support and victory, and that the blessed Al-Aqsa Mosque would be liberated from the clutches of the Israeli occupation, and that the holy month of Ramadan would be a decisive turning point towards the Palestinian people regaining their rights, achieving their destiny and establishing their independent state with Al-Quds Al-Sharif as its capital. He also prayed to Allah Almighty to make this holy month an end to the tragedies and pains of all Muslims and an occasion for the return of the displaced and refugees to their homes and homelands. 

The Secretary-General stressed that the holy month of Ramadan is a month of fasting and prayer for all Muslims, and an opportunity to practice the values of goodness, compassion and solidarity, and to preserve lives and spread the spirit of peace, calling for extending a helping hand to the needy, the destitute and those suffering from harsh conditions in refugee and displacement camps. – OIC News
